A user recently uncovered a stash of Bitcoin valued at roughly $25,000 in an old wallet, igniting a wave of reactions across various forums. This unexpected discovery has led to discussions not only about the value of dormant cryptocurrencies but also about the perils of digital security in the crypto world.
The excitement surrounding this wallet find highlights the growing interest in cryptocurrencies. Users have shared stories of their own fortunes and misfortunes with Bitcoin, emphasizing the potential for both profit and loss in the volatile market.
